Alfred Gradjeda was the commanding officer of the First Free Worlds Guards as of 3037.[2]

History[edit]

During the Andurien Secession, the First Free Worlds Guards and Twenty-fifth Marik Militia were dispatched to take the rebellious planet Cursa in late 3036. While the planet's garrison was quickly defeated, a bomb attack on the First Guards' command center in January 3037 killed the unit's commanding officer and announced the Fourth Defenders of Andurien's presence on the world. Force Commander Gradjeda took command of the Free Worlds forces and prevented them from being overrun by the surprise attack before launching into a three-month campaign against the Fourth Defenders. While the Fourth Defenders eventually withdrew to Andurien in May, the brutalization of the First Guards humiliated the unit and the accompanying Twenty-fifth Militia were rendered inoperable as a fighting force.[2]

Later, during the fighting for Andurien itself, Gradjeda's Guards were given the opportunity to avenge their losses on Cursa. On 19 August 3039, the First Guards engaged the Fourth Defenders west of the Darnel Bridge in four days of vicious fighting. The First Guards refused to disengage due to their desire for revenge while the Fourth Defenders refused to retreat in order to deprive the League of one of its best units. While the Fourth Defenders were destroyed by the end of the battle, Gradjeda's men had endured so many losses that they were rotated off the line of combat and would only rejoin the fight for Andurien during the later battle for the city of Jojoken.[3]

By 3050, now-Colonel Gradjeda continued to command the First Free Worlds Guards and was stationed on Berenson.[1]
